2011 AZN to CRC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the AZN to CRC ex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on October 11, valuing the pair at 657.4813.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on April 19, dropping to 623.5487.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 33.9326 CRC.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 630.9886 to the December average rate of 637.6075, the exchange rate registered a net change of 1.05%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 657.4813 was down 7.64% compared to the 2010 peak of 711.8535,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
